The color #719E80 is a grayish green that can be used in various design contexts. This color has RGB values of 113, 158, 128 and HSL values of 140°, 19%, 53%.

Complementary Colors for #719E80
The complementary color for #719E80 is #9E708F. These colors sit opposite each other on the color wheel and create a striking visual contrast when used together.
Shades of #719E80
These are the darker variations of #719E80. Shades are created by adding black to the original color, like #5A7E66 and #445F4D. This progression shows how #719E80 darkens from left to right, creating deeper variations of the original color.
